			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-342" title="ps3_move" src="http://www.top-ps3-games.co.uk/blog/wp-content/somefiles/ps3_move.jpg" alt="ps3_move" width="280" height="196" />There have been a lot of speculations about the PlayStation move addition to the PS3 and thankfully we were one of the first to try this miracle of modern engineering. Only a few minutes were enough to determine that the PS Move was way better than the controller of the Nintendo Wii.</p>
<p>Most of you know that the Wii has been the most successful platform which gives you not only a quality gaming experience, but also the ability to work out while playing your favorite games. Taking that in mind, it is easy to conclude that the Wii platform isn’t an easy one to beat, however, it provides a limited array of options while the PS3 literally buries you under extras and options. You get not only Blu-ray movies, but also the opportunity to play the latest games with either a joystick or with the brand new PlayStation move platform which is sure to give you an unforgettable experience.</p>
<p>Sony were slowly losing the market to the Wii and they had to make an innovation which would bring the customers back to them and they have done just that thanks to the PS Move which is able to attract even the most hardcore gamers. The testing of the platform began with a lot of skepticism, because Sony had to create a true marvel in order to beat the Nintendo Wii.</p>
<p>The first game will try isn’t something fancy and famous, but instead a simple game called “Start the party” which includes everyday activities and can be played by the entire family, meaningless of the age. Mostly the game includes housework like painting, arranging, tidying and etc, but can include also painting for instance.</p>
<p>Although the PS3 Move is a great piece of hardware, you also need some good software in order to uncover its true capabilities and the game “Start the Party” does exactly that by providing you with the opportunity to fully test the PS3 Move controls and abilities. The first test wasn’t by us, but instead by my family and I can tell you that I was satisfied that I saw the smiles on both my grandparents and children while playing this game, because this was a sure sign that Sony have done an amazing job. If we take a look on the hardware aspects, the combination of the controller and camera which the PS3 Move provides gives the user a lot of opportunities to perform moves that the Nintendo Wii can just dream about.</p>
<p>The second game which had to be tested was the “Sports Champions” and as you can tell by the name it includes a lot of sports races and competitions. Of course every game must be started with certain control arrangements and calibrations in order to achieve the maximum comfort and afterwards you can start gaming. The first game was table tennis and was played by both players which meant that the TV screen had to be split in two, however, this is just a minor flaw. While playing with the tennis bat it was impossible to not notice the flawless moves which were performed on the screen and that the PS Move was able to sense even the smallest movements. The lag which was noticed in some games played on the Nintendo Wii was a thing of the past with the PS Move.</p>
<p>Of course we couldn’t reach to a final overall grade of the PS Move from just two games and we had to try more so the next stop was the archery competition from the “Sports Champions” game and we can say that we were well surprised by the possibilities of the PS Move. The game was again played by two people and this included extra expense for an extra motion controller, but if you want to see the maximum potential of the Wii – this is the way to do it. When you grab a hold of the bow you definitely can get a feeling you are right on the field and are ready to take a shot for victory. Taking an arrow from the quiver on your shoulder and then putting in the bow is an amazing feeling. Afterwards it was time to stretch for 100% power and the wait for the releasing of the “T” button which would unleash the power of the bow.</p>
<p>There were also other games which we tested like the “Kung Fu Rider”, but this game seemed like too much arcade style and it didn’t have the capabilities to show the full potential of the PS Move. Another all-time favorite of the video gamer which was tested was the Resident Evil 5: Gold Edition and since this is a FPS the controls were a bit strange, but with some tuning and playing it was easy to get used to them. Of course we can’t expect from every game to be suitable for the PS Move and this game was just that – it just seemed better to play it with a regular controller than with the PS Move.</p>
<p>This are basically the first impressions which the PS Move leaves in us, but this is a new platform and it is going to be improved with time and there also aren’t many games suitable for the PS Move at this time. This will change with time and the new games will definitely have a better PS Move support and show the full capabilities of this platform.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-339" title="bluray3d" src="http://www.top-ps3-games.co.uk/blog/wp-content/somefiles/bluray3d.jpeg" alt="bluray3d" width="274" height="184" />The latest firmware update, version 3.50, allows the playstation to play Blu-ray 3D movies. Though there are not many 3D movies currently available, some studios have planned a 3D range in time for Christmas, such as A Christmas Carol and Clash of the Titans.</p>
<p>You will need a compatible 3D TV to view the content, and a set of compatible glasses. 3D is being pushed heavily by the industry, though it has mixed responses from consumers. The main complaints being having to buy glasses for all members of the family, and for some unlucky viewers experiencing sickness and headaches. So it may not be a useful update for all PS3 owners.</p>
<p>However, there are two additional features that may make the update worthwhile.</p>
<p>First, there is FaceBook integration that allows game developers to access public FaceBook information such as user name, profile, photos and list.</p>
<p>Second, there is a &#8216;grief reporting function&#8217;, that will let users inform Sony of users sending inappropriate messages sent via the Playstation Network.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="size-medium wp-image-327 alignleft" src="http://www.top-ps3-games.co.uk/blog/wp-content/somefiles/GT5-special-1jpg-300x253.jpg" alt="GT5-special-1jpg" width="300" height="253" />Today on the PlayStation 3 EU Blog, Penrose Tackie – European Brand Manager for PlayStation  EU has given many juicy details about the upcoming epic GT5 racing game for the PS3, and here&#8217;s the skinny:</p>
<blockquote><p>“I am absolutely delighted to be able bring what will hopefully be  very exciting news to those patiently (or impatiently) waiting for more  information on Gran Turismo 5. During E3, our American colleagues  unveiled their rather tasty looking Collector’s Edition. Today I can now  confirm the special editions of Gran Turismo that will be heading  Europe’s way later this year.</p>
<p>First up, we have a very special version  of the game; one that, with its artfully sculpted exterior, glossy  black finish and meticulously designed premium content, exemplifies  everything the Gran Turismo brand has always stood for – beauty and  precision.”</p></blockquote>
<div style="overflow: hidden;color: #000000;background-color: transparent;text-align: left;text-decoration: none;border: medium none">Pictured is the Collectors Edition, which won&#8217;t be cheap (€179.99 EU price), but will come with loads of exclusive goodies, including:</div>
<ul>
<li>Metal sculpted box finished in SLS AMG Obsidian Black</li>
<li>Exclusive GT branded SLS AMG 1:43 model car</li>
<li>GT leather wallet containing Signature Edition competition entry card</li>
<li>Branded USB key with Polyphony/Mercedes-Benz trailer</li>
<li>GT branded metal key fob</li>
<li>Signature Edition coffee table book featuring the beautiful cars and locations of Gran Turismo 5</li>
<li>200 page Apex drivers magazine with hints on driving technique, car tuning, future technologies and more</li>
</ul>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="size-medium wp-image-318 alignleft" src="http://www.top-ps3-games.co.uk/blog/wp-content/somefiles/explodemon-PS3.thumbnail-300x124.jpg" alt="explodemon-PS3.thumbnail" width="300" height="124" />PS3 owners will be treated to the release of <em>Explodemon!</em>, which will be hitting PlayStation Network with a bang this early Q4, and it&#8217;ll be interesting to see how it performs.</p>
<p>More about via their website:</p>
<blockquote><p><em>Explodemon!</em> is a 2.5D platform action game brought kicking  and screaming into the  HD era. Influenced by classic Japanese games  from the golden era of the  SNES, players use Explodemon’s  self-destructive nature to combat enemies  and fly through the air, all  the while solving a huge variety of  physics-based puzzles (and,  naturally, causing incalculable collateral  damage).</p>
<p>When the peaceful planet of Nibia is attacked by the  malicious  Vortex forces, the fate of the star system is thrust into the  one pair  of hands it shouldn’t be: the malfunctioning Guardian robot  Explodemon.  His comic quest to repel the onslaught and restore peace  will take him  across three distinct planets over twelve levels, with new  abilities  and gameplay mechanics introduced throughout.</p></blockquote>
<p>We like the description: sort of a Japanese platformer combined with elements of Myst and a dash of Final Fantasy. We&#8217;ll update as this story warrants.</p>
